Bruce Lee – Enter the Dragon/The Game of Death
Like his son, Bruce Lee died while working on a film. He was dubbing Enter the Dragon and collapsed in the studio. He died shortly after being rushed to the hospital. His death was attributed to cerebral edema. The exact cause of the edema is still not known today. There was speculation that marijuana was responsible (it was 1973, after all) or that it could have been a combination of the painkillers and muscle relaxants he was taking. His film Game of Death was never completed, though footage from it was used with new footage to make a film (simply titled Game of Death, removing the “The”) that was released five years later.
